Hi,

The installation of freeipmi from tarbal has been my problem in FreeBSD(even in 
6.2 before). No problem when installing this from ports, but I should want to 
try the latest one as the ported one is not automatically updated.  AFAIK, the 
dependencies are the below:

security/libgpg-error
security/libgcrypt
devel/argp-standalone

I started installing libcrypt. This was successfully installed. Then proceed w/ 
freeipmi 
(http://ftp.zresearch.com/pub/freeipmi/qa-release/freeipmi-0.7.3.beta1.tar.gz) 
compilation.

I always get errors like:

checking how to run the C++ preprocessor... g++ -E
checking for g77... no
checking for f77... no
checking for xlf... no
checking for frt... no

.....
Then end up with
.....
checking whether make sets $(MAKE)... (cached) yes
checking for gcry_md_open in -lgcrypt... no
configure: error: libgcrypt required to build libfreeipmi


Attached are the logs for installing libcrypt and compiling freeipmi.

Any help pls.
